## Title: Senior Medical Officer

Job Summary

We are seeking a Senior Medical Officer to join our dynamic healthcare team. This role combines advanced clinical practice with leadership responsibilities, overseeing clinical operations and supporting effective medical governance within the facility. You will supervise junior medical staff while maintaining the highest standards of professional, ethical, and regulatory compliance.

Key Responsibilities

Clinical Duties

  • Provide comprehensive medical consultations, diagnosis, and treatment for patients
  • Manage complex and high-risk medical cases and coordinate referrals where required
  • Prescribe medications and treatments in line with approved clinical protocols
  • Perform and interpret relevant diagnostic tests and procedures
  • Ensure continuity of care through proper documentation, follow-up, and patient reviews

Leadership & Supervision

  • Supervise and mentor Medical Officers, House Officers, Interns, and other clinical staff
  • Review and approve clinical notes, prescriptions, and treatment plans prepared by junior staff where applicable
  • Lead ward rounds, clinical meetings, and case reviews as assigned
  • Support training, performance evaluation, and professional development of medical staff

Clinical Governance & Compliance

  • Ensure strict compliance with hospital policies, clinical guidelines, and ethical standards
  • Maintain accurate, complete, and timely medical records in accordance with legal requirements
  • Uphold infection prevention and control standards at all times

Administrative & Operational Responsibilities

  • Assist in planning and coordinating daily clinical operations
  • Provide clinical input into reports, service improvement initiatives, and health programs
  • Participate in multidisciplinary team meetings and hospital committees as required

Patient & Stakeholder Relations

  • Communicate clearly and compassionately with patients and their families
